Transaction 589e4f211869372a92e0c4c6e21c6e4de395b0de544cc55cb0291f197a7546c4
1 Input
1 Output
-
589e4f211869372a92e0c4c6e21c6e4de395b0de544cc55cb0291f197a7546c4:0
- value
- 2665000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da3b483d0ee79aee4ad03d5052496a8d15618779 OP_EQUAL
- address
- 3MavFMtayepB5i8hUFFvSmQ6nAC9XmXgjh